A ratio compares two quantities. For example, if there are 3 boys and 5 girls in a group, the ratio of boys to girls is 3:5 (read "3 to 5"). Ratios can also be written as fractions (3/5) or with the word "to" (3 to 5). Ratios help us compare amounts and understand relationships between numbers in recipes, maps, and many real-world situations.
